Transaction 31696b886d11a167a809cdaa50214d0663d450014be220d136b184272da17030
1 Input
1 Output
-
31696b886d11a167a809cdaa50214d0663d450014be220d136b184272da17030:0
- value
- 71701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52cda2d4434c9379305cc8cf0ce03104157a12c3 OP_EQUAL
- address
- 39Eqg7kSyAM8zpVsZu6id5HVKDaPk3qNb7